Overview
The 40th anniversary edition of the enduring outdoors classic from the acknowledged master of fishing writers, John Gierach, including new, previously unpublished material and a foreword from Liam Neeson.
John Gierach didn’t just write about fly-fishing—he helped transform the sport from a niche pursuit to a way of life. As he once said: “Fly-fishing for trout is a sport that depends not so much on catching the fish as on their mere presence and the fact that you do, now and again, catch some.” This is exactly the kind of simultaneously wise and deadpan observation that has earned him a devoted following for over four decades.
With his inimitable blend of wit and insight, Gierach brings the rivers and landscapes of the Rocky Mountains to life, and takes us on fly-fishing adventures that turn out to be by turns challenging, exhilarating, philosophical, comical, and unexpectedly revelatory, proving that Trout Bum is about more than fishing—it’s about life.
